Lake Owyhee State Park
Lake Owyhee State Park is a state park campground near Adrian, Oregon. This beginner friendly-level campground offers tent camping, car camping. No fees.

About This Location
Discover the remote beauty of Lake Owyhee State Park in eastern Oregon. A perfect year-round destination for tent and car campers seeking rugged landscapes.
Lake Owyhee State Park offers a unique escape into the dramatic, high-desert landscape of eastern Oregon. Located just under ten miles from the town of Adrian, this park serves as a gateway to the stunning Owyhee Canyonlands, where volcanic rock formations and expansive vistas create a breathtaking backdrop for outdoor enthusiasts. The region is known for its quiet, rugged beauty, making it an ideal destination for those looking to disconnect and immerse themselves in the natural wonders of the Pacific Northwest.
This location is primarily suited for tent and car campers who appreciate a back-to-basics experience. As a year-round destination, the park provides consistent access to the scenic surroundings regardless of the season, allowing visitors to enjoy the shifting colors and atmosphere of the high desert. Whether you are planning a quick weekend getaway or a longer exploration of the nearby terrain, the park provides a peaceful home base.
The campground is managed by Oregon State Parks and is well-regarded as a beginner-friendly environment for those new to camping. While the area is remote, it remains accessible for visitors traveling from the surrounding regions. If you are looking for a tranquil spot to set up camp while exploring the unique geological features of the Owyhee area, this state park is an excellent choice.
